	On Wed, Jul 12, 2000, Andrzej Bialecki wrote:
	> Hi,
	> 
	> I've been tweaking the sysctls here and there for some time
	> now, and I'd like to see what is the current opinion on
	> implementing sysctl tree as a filesystem. Most of the work
	> I've done with dynamic sysctls is very similar to what
	> happens with filesystem. Also, filesystem model allows for
	> much more fine-grained access control.
	> 

If you are still interested in doing this, see `man kernfs'
which is a prototype of a filesystem designed to show (and 
in some cases modify) kernel information.
